Not sure if something like this was posted already but probably was, I was aggravated taking off the seat attachment screw and a friend suggested putting in a thumb screw, found one but another friend had a better idea:
Get a knob from a automotive cb bracket *black or chrome, and use it. Found one that was the exact same size in a couple of minutes at a truck stop and put it in, What a great idea. Reach under the tour pack remove it by hand and lift the seat. HOpe this idea helps' someone.

Ace Hardware has a nice selection of knobbed screws that work well too. I got one for the seat and the strap that runs accross the seat on an Ultra.
